免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发工具python

Python是一种高级的编程语言,它具有简单易学、功能强大、可读性强等特点。Python的应用范围非常广泛,其中包含移动App开发。Python可以帮助开发人员快速构建简单又易维护的App,通过简单的API接口可以与其他语言集成,降低开发人员的工作量和开发成本。

Python的特点:

1. 简单易学:Python语法非常简单,容易学习。

2. 高效性:Python可以快速编写代码,并且在不同的平台上运行。

3. 可读性强:Python的代码风格具有可读性,易于代码的修改和维护。

4. 强大的社区支持:Python拥有广泛的开发者社区,可以寻求对问题的答案和开源代码。

5. 跨平台兼容:Python可以在各种操作系统和硬件平台上运行。

6. 支持面向对象编程。

7. 能够处理大数据量。

8. 支持自动化代码测试和调试。

Python的应用领域:

1. 数据科学和机器学习:Python被广泛应用于数据分析、数据可视化、自然语言处理等领域。

2. 网络编程:Python具有编写服务器端应用程序和创建网络应用程序的功能。

3. 人工智能:Python有着很好的机器学习和深度学习的支持,因此在人工智能的领域中占有一定的地位。

4. 游戏开发:Python也被用于视频游戏开发,尤其是非商业性质游戏中。

5. 自动化测试:Python可以大大降低测试工程师的工作量,且有着非常好的自动化测试框架。

6. Web应用开发:Python可以用于编写Web应用程序,有着优秀的Web框架,如Django、TurboGears。

Python的app开发工具:

1. Kivy:Kivy是一个跨平台的开源Python库,它可以用于开发针对多点触控屏幕的移动和桌面应用程序。

2. PyQT:PyQT是基于Qt库的Python模块,允许开发人员使用Python语言来编写图形用户界面 (GUI) 应用程序。

3. Tkinter:Tkinter是一个Python库,用于创建和管理GUI应用程序。

4. PyGTK:PyGTK是GTK+开发的Python模块,它允许开发人员使用Python语言来编写跨平台的桌面应用程序。

总而言之,Python是一种功能强大、可读性强的编程语言,可以用于移动App的开发工作。开发人员可以使用Python开发库和框架来加速移动应用程序的开发,降低开发成本。Python的应用领域非常广泛,包括数据科学、人工智能和游戏开发。


相关知识:
app开发页面代码是多少
APP开发页面代码的具体内容和长度会根据不同的开发平台和编程语言而有所不同。下面我将以Android平台为例,简要介绍APP页面代码的基本结构和原理。在Android开发中,每个页面都由一个XML布局文件和一个对应的Java类文件组成。XML布局文件用于描
2023-06-29
app开发文字转语音
App开发中文字转语音功能的实现原理主要涉及两个方面:文本处理和语音合成。一、文本处理1. 分词:将输入的文本按照一定的规则进行切分,得到一个个单词或词组。常用的分词算法有正向最大匹配法、逆向最大匹配法、双向最大匹配法等。2. 词性标注:对分词结果进行词性
2023-06-29
app开发中的经常遇到的问题
在App开发过程中,开发者经常会遇到一些常见的问题。下面我将详细介绍一些常见的问题及其解决方法。1. 编译错误:在开发过程中,我们经常会遇到编译错误。这些错误可能是语法错误、缺少依赖库或者命名冲突等。解决这些问题的方法是仔细检查代码,确保语法正确,并检查依
2023-06-29
app开发程序培训
在互联网的高速发展时代,App已经成为了人们日常生活中离不开的一部分。许多企业和创业者都渴望为自己的项目和业务开发一个定制化的App。但是对于大多数人来说,App开发仍然是一个陌生的领域。本文将为您提供一个入门级别的App开发培训,介绍App开发的基本原理
2023-06-29
app开发步骤解密
在当今信息时代,手机应用已经成为我们日常生活中不可或缺的一部分,人们用手机应用来购物、社交、学习等等。要了解App开发的步骤,首先需要明确App的定义。App即为“应用程序”(Application),是指一种设计好的、可在手机、平板电脑等移动设备上运行的
2023-06-29
app开发故障排除
移动App的开发已经成为企业和开发者的必需品,它们为用户提供了各种各样的服务和便利,打造了商业成功的基础之一。然而,与其它应用程序一样,移动App开发不是一帆风顺的,总会出现一些故障和错误。因此,理解移动App开发故障排除的原理和方法就变得至关重要。1.日
2023-06-29